Moderator's Report

Complaint made that gaps in the field are opening up during warm up lap, specific complaint made by Johnny Dee that "JonM opens a huge gap to the leaders" at the chicane before the start finish straight. In my opinion JonM has not deliberately opened up a gap and its certainly not a huge gap. He is doing his best to maintain station. Looking at the replay, the gaps do seem to increase as you look further down the order, however, I think this is caused more by the cautious attitude of drivers slowing down to enter the final turn whilst the cars in front have/are accelerating slowly back to warm up pace.


Server replay time: 209s

JohnnyDee states that going into the Old Hairpin, JonM brakes too soon, "the replay shows that I keep the leaders' pace but he drops back". JohnnyDee locks the brakes going into the turn, then accelerates to fast on exit causing the back to step out.
This is the first hot lap of the race, many drivers will be a little cautious of cold tyres and brakes on the first couple of laps and will brake earlier than normal, JohnnyDee should have been aware of this, as to the repaly showing he keeps to the leaders pace....Johnny is in 11th place, the only cars he should be concerned with are the ones immediately in front of him, his driving into the Old Hairpin was too aggressive causing him to lock the front under braking and his off track excurssion is caused by over eager use of the accelerator causing the back to step out. None of these incidents are the fault of JonM.

  • Racing incident


Server replay time: 263s

Dave Gymer and JonM are racing down the back straight, Dave has pulled out in an obvious attempt to pass Jon under braking into the chicane. Dave realises that Edam Speed is coming in fast at the chicane and pulls back onto the racing line to avoid being rear ended.

Edam Speed makes an excellent late brake into the chicane and passes Bernie Lomax and Dave Gymer, it was a well controlled pass and no contact is made. What worried me about this manouevre is that if Dave hadn't seen Edam coming in fast and moved back to the racing line there would without doubt been an accident here. Edam had a clear view and could see Dave G was on his line and should take that into account before contemplating such a move. The next time may not see such consideration from the driver in front. All said and done though, it was a cracking move Edam.

  • EdamSpeedcaution — A litle more consideration and awareness please.


Server replay time: 264s

Approaching the final chicane, Bernie Lomax slows to avoid contact with Dave Gymer who has moved back onto the racing line to avoid being hit by Edam Speed. JohnnyDee is already braking hard and cannot avoid tapping Bernie.

  • Racing incident


Server replay time: 266s

Eddie Myer approaches the chicane and attempts to take advantage of the slower cars in front, he locks the front on turn in, takes a substantial cut across the first part of the chicane and hits JohnnyDee. He then leaves no room at all for JohnnyDee through the left had turn of the chicane resulting in further impact and loss of places to both drivers.

  • Eddie Meyerpenalty — Poor passing manouevre — 2 places lost


Server replay time: 285s

Whitham69 gets a good run down the S/F straight on JohnnyDee but unfortunately has a slight loss of control under braking for Redgate, this causes him to swerve slighlty left before regaing control and side impacting JohnnyDee. This causes Johnny to be pushed out left and in getting the car back under control Johnny turns right more acutely than he would normally and side impacts Jamera. Jamera who had a good view of what was happening had back off going into Redgate and was more the innocent bystander.

  • whitham69penalty — Loss of control resulting in side collision — 2 places lost (plus 1 for penalty points)


Server replay time: 302s

Jamera takes a wider and slower line into the Craner Curves allowing JohnnyDee to gain rapidly on him. As they go through the fast left Jamera contines to turn in towards the racing line with Johnny moving inside, Johnny makes no allowance for this but continues at full throttle through the turn knowing full well the car ahead is turning in and his own speed and momentum through the turn will cause him to drift out. Side contact is inevitable.

  • JohnnyDee ([GS]JohnnyDee)penalty — Over aggressive manouevre resulting in side impact — 2 places lost
    For advice only - unreported by victim, so penalty disregarded


Server replay time: 316s

Don goes wide at the Old Hairpin allowing Edam Speed to close the gap heading towards Schwantz curve. As they approach McLeans Edam has the inside line, but hes a little too fast and slides into Don. Fortunately Don holds it together but at the cost of a position.

  • EdamSpeedpenalty — Side impact — 2 places lost
    For advice only - unreported by victim, so penalty disregarded


Server replay time: 320s

JohnnyDee gets inside Whitham69 going into McLeans with Jamera following behind. JohnnyDee doesnt get the acceleration coming off the corner due to his tighter line, Jamera gets a good run through the turn then realises JohnnyDee is picking up speed, you can clearly hear Jamera come off the gas. Unfortunately Jamera doesnt slow quickly enough and taps Johnny's rear. Both cars continue without loss of position.

  • Racing incident


Server replay time: 372s

Bernie Lomax loses the rear entering Redgate spinning the car round. Sponsored By Gingsters is unsighted due to Popabawa and is making an attempted pass on Tom Cooper round the outside down the S/F straight. Gingsters did not see Bernie until he turned and with Tom inside him has litlle time to react. Gingsters hits Bernie throwing Gingsters car into the path of JohnnyDee who hits him quite hard. This forces Gingsters to retire.

  • Racing incident


Server replay time: 510s

Eddie Myer goes through McLeans, on accelerating out he gets a slight rear slide. JohnnyDee has followed Eddie through the turn cleanly, Johnny comes off the gas but really has little chance to react and taps Eddies rear.

  • Racing incident


Server replay time: 667s

Eddie Meyer goes wide at the Old Hairpin and JohnnyDee makes a good pass down the inside. As Eddie wrestles the car off the rumble strip and back to the track there is side contact between them.

  • Racing incident


Server replay time: 1142s

JohnnyDee and Whitham69 are heading towards the final chicane, Johnny brakes far to late and goes straight on into the tyre wall and had to retire. I would not have normally have moderated this report, letting it go as a non accident as no one but Johnny was involved. However, Johnnys late braking could have so nearly taken Whitham out as well. I hope Johnnys close self examination of his drive at Donnington and subsequent reports has highlighted that his sometimes aggressive driving style can be dangerous. Johnny also displayed some excellent driving skills and I hope he takes some valueable lessons away from this and so improve on those skills.

  • Racing incident

UKGTL Championship - Season 1-ish, Round 1 at Donington Park National

Date: Thursday 25th May

Practice: 8:30pm (15 mins)
Qualifying: 8:45pm (20 mins)
Race: 9:05pm (28 laps)

Cars allowed: Alfa Romeo GTA or Lotus Cortina
Time Of Day: 12:00

Server: UKGTL Season 1-ish
Password: usual practice password

Notes:
(1) It's best if all drivers can make sure they are connected before the Qualifying session as drivers on track during qualifying will not see cars that join after they are on track until they go back to the garage.
